Discovering Peckham: A Transformation to Watch

Peckham, located in the London Borough of Southwark, is a district that has experienced an astonishing transformation in recent years. Once seen as a less desirable area, Peckham has undergone revitalization, drawing in a diverse mix of residents, including young professionals, creatives, and families. The neighborhood’s newfound popularity has made it one of the most exciting areas for property investment in London.

A Cultural and Artistic Hub

At the heart of Peckham’s charm is its creative energy. The area boasts a thriving arts scene, with galleries, independent art spaces, and cultural venues like Peckham Levels, which is home to artists, music studios, and even a rooftop bar. The creative vibe is complemented by a variety of independent shops, music venues, and street art that infuses the area with a unique atmosphere, making it a highly attractive option for those seeking a dynamic and lively environment.

Exceptional Transport Links

A crucial factor when choosing where to buy property in London is transport links, and Peckham excels in this area.

Quick Access to Central London

Peckham Rye Station provides Overground and National Rail services to key destinations across London, including London Bridge, Victoria, and Shoreditch. With travel times of around 15 minutes to central London, Peckham is an ideal location for commuters. Additionally, the area benefits from a network of bus routes and bike lanes, ensuring that residents have multiple options for getting around.

Future Developments

Peckham’s transport network is set to expand further, with the ongoing development of new infrastructure and transport links to the surrounding areas. The proposed extension of the Bakerloo Line to Peckham, currently in planning stages, will make the area even more accessible to central London, which is likely to increase demand for property even further.

Green Spaces in Peckham: An Urban Oasis

Amidst the hustle and bustle of London life, Peckham offers an abundance of green spaces where residents can relax and unwind.

Peckham Rye Park and Burgess Park

Peckham Rye Park is a local favorite, providing a large open space complete with a picturesque lake, walking trails, and sports facilities. The park also plays host to a range of events throughout the year, including outdoor concerts and festivals. For those who want even more green space, nearby Burgess Park offers a larger area for outdoor activities, including sports fields, playgrounds, and a beautiful pond.

These parks provide a peaceful escape from city life and make Peckham an ideal location for families, pet owners, and anyone who values access to nature.
